Yet, their GPUs still weren’t as in style as Nvidia’s lately. PLC known as a programmable logic controller, it has specially designed computer to operate in an industrial setting, which may operate … The time period WAN full form is extensive space network, it can be used much-advanced expertise such as ATM, SONET, frame relay and many extra. Contributing Editor Peter Varhol covers the HPC and IT beat for Digital Engineering. His expertise is software improvement, math methods, and systems management. Contributing Editor Peter Varhol covers the HPC and IT beat for DE.
We just talked about how memory entry can take a number of cycles. Thus to make the most of the GPU cores more effectively we swap between threads. If one thread is stuck ready for input knowledge on a daily CPU, you turn to a different thread.
One of probably the most commonly used abbreviations by tech lovers, reviewers, bloggers, and so on., is CPU and GPU. The algorithm can initially be compute-bound on the first degree of the hierarchy, after which to turn into memory-bound at larger levels of the hierarchy. For the GPU, the value of world memory bandwidth might vary in a variety.
This was covered in a recent blog where a collaboration between Samtec and Alphawave was used to generate 31-bit, PRBS data at 112 Gbps PAM4 over 12″ of 34 AWG cable. The programming of the FPGA actually defines the hardware function of the device. When the operate needs to vary, the FPGA may be merely reprogrammed. This signifies that the FPGA can be programmed after which reprogrammed to a desired software or operate. The Field Programmable Gate Array can be a silicon primarily based semiconductor, however it’s based on a matrix of configurable logic blocks that are connected by programmable interconnects. When cryptocurrency mining gained popularity, the GPU was used as a method of solving the complicated mathematical algorithms used.
Gpus: Key To Ai, Laptop Imaginative And Prescient, Supercomputing And Extra
Peak pressures on the base and entrance face are compared with experiment and linear (potential-flow) theory. The experiments used periodic targeted waves which confirmed some variation in type about a peak crest although crest elevations had been repeatable, and these are reproduced within the mannequin. Converged incompressible SPH values are in approximate agreement with both. Overtopping of the box shows qualitative agreement with experiment. While linear theory can’t account for overtopping or viscous (eddy-shedding) results, submerged stress prediction offers a helpful approximation. Quite complex vorticity era and eddy shedding is predicted with free-surface interaction.
- However, a CPU isn’t as crucial for gaming as a GPU is, as it’s the GPU that does a lot of the heavy lifting in relation to rendering detailed 3D environments in real-time.
- The most evident one is that you simply don’t need to spend any cash on an expensive graphics card.
- In a component inspection application, it may be the case that by the point the frame reaches the appliance, the half in query has already moved on.
- It is the responsibility of the CPU to execute the knowledge received from the reminiscence.
- Fast rising merchants depend ServerGuy for high-performance hosting.
This is extremely necessary for real-time examine processing and fraud detection. GPUs are able to processing thousands of photographs simultaneously, returning the leads to milliseconds vs CPUs which do not have the processing power to achieve actual real-time processing. The first APU, utilizing codename Llano, was announced by AMD back in 2011, however the project had been in the works since about 2006. For example, the Intel Core-i7-8700K, commonly paired with a powerful dedicated GPU, does have Intel UHD Graphics 630 constructed right in.
Often compared to the “brains” of your device, the central processing unit, or CPU, is a silicon chip that’s attached to a socket on the motherboard. The CPU is responsible for everything you are able to do on a pc, executing instructions for packages from your system’s memory by way of billions of microscopic transistors with instructions from software. It’s like having billions of on-off switches that management the circulate of electrical energy, translating duties into 0’s and 1’s. In particular, high-end GPUs, such because the NVIDIA Tesla, require full-bandwidth PCIe Gen 2 x16 slots that do not degrade to x8 speeds when a quantity of GPUs are used. Also, InfiniBand QDR interconnect is extremely desirable to match the GPU-to-host bandwidth. Because they have an structure composed of many parallel cores and optimized pixel math, GPUs very successfully course of pictures and draw graphics.
Power-efficient Time-sensitive Mapping In Heterogeneous Methods
But what sets a GPU apart vs a CPU and why do graphics and different specialised tasks need one? While GPU’s clock velocity is decrease than that of recent CPUs , the number of cores on each GPU chip is way denser. In truth, this is among the most notable differences between a graphics card and a CPU.
- SPH is a particle meshless method with the advantages and issues inherent to its Lagrangian nature.
- After the multilevel optimization is applied, advanced algorithms will return results inside an affordable time interval, comparable to the velocity of fast however crude algorithms.
- This causes the CPU to decrease the frequency to keep away from overheating.
- This quantity is split into 32 real threads, inside which SIMT execution is organized.
- With 20+ years of experience in constructing cloud-native providers and safety solutions, Nolan Foster spearheads Public Cloud and Managed Security Services at Ace Cloud Hosting.
For example, we noticed that in our arms the TPUs were ~3x sooner than CPUs and ~3x slower than GPUs for performing a small variety of predictions . If you need to maintain your PC updated or usually want to spend much less cash for a similar efficiency, a gaming desktop will outperform a similarly priced laptop computer and you’ll normally improve the elements later on. You may even stream your gaming desktop to your laptop computer with distant streaming software, which is a boon for these with nice internet connection. But gaming laptops nonetheless hold the edge for portability and lag-free on-line gaming in comparability with a desktop stream or cloud gaming. Some video games like Civilization VI and Europa Universalis 4 aren’t as graphics-intensive as most on this class, but their CPU-intensive load needs a high-end processor to maintain up. So where do all the latest CPUs and GPUs fall on the ladder of sunshine to heavy gaming?
Gpu Versus Cpu: Which One Is More Essential For Gaming?
For this reason, they’ve significantly faster read/write occasions. SSDs that characteristic non-volatile reminiscence express connections are even quicker, as they link directly to the computer’s PCIe lanes. In such cases, all directions ought to be processed within a single task in a GPU. The data from the supply can be replicated as soon as in a GPU, and by the tip of the pipeline, the computational outcomes are given to the CPU. And, in cases like these, the intermediate knowledge stays only with the CPU.
The scalar software program mannequin hides the vector essence of the hardware, automating and simplifying many operations. That is why it’s easier for many software engineers to write down the usual scalar code in SIMT than vector code in pure SIMD. As the window dimension grows, the algorithm turns into extra complex and shifts in path of compute-bound accordingly. Most picture processing algorithms are memory-bound at the international reminiscence degree. And for the explanation that global memory bandwidth of the GPU is in plenty of instances an order of magnitude higher than that of the CPU, this offers a comparable efficiency acquire.
What Is A Processing Unit?
For instance, many sports and wedding ceremony photographers love Photo Mechanic for its velocity in culling photographs. Some future Photoshop replace might decelerate because gpu compare of new options or pace up as a end result of optimized code. Should you opt for a CPU/APU with integrated graphics or go with a devoted GPU and CPU.
Virtual Servers
When we’re speaking about these sorts of algorithms, it is important to perceive that we suggest a specific implementation of the algorithm on a selected architecture. It is very important to hold in mind that these outcomes are obtained for the CPU solely in the case of using AVX2 instructions. In the case of utilizing scalar instructions, the CPU efficiency is lowered by 8 instances, each in arithmetic operations and in the reminiscence throughput. Therefore, for modern CPUs, software optimization is of particular significance. For the needs of this article, we’ll focus specifically on quick picture processing algorithms that have such characteristics as locality, parallelizability, and relative simplicity. GPU may help enhance the efficiency of the CPU by taking on extra tasks and processing them in a parallel style to save heaps of time and assets.
The Graphics Processing Unit is specifically designed processor for performing graphics-based duties whereas relieving Central Processing Unit to perform different computing duties. Traditionally, GPUs had been addons to desktops to improve tasks that involved graphics processing. Now, Apps4Rent provides GPUs that could be added in a devoted mode to Cloud desktops and servers, or on Microsoft’s Azure cloud infrastructure. Over time, Microsoft began to work more closely with hardware builders and started to focus on the releases of DirectX to coincide with these of the supporting graphics hardware. They are also key enablers in phrases of the growth of areas corresponding to artificial intelligence .
Every 12 months, the need for RAM continues to be increasing, however this is happening at a comparatively clean tempo. If the processor assets are inadequate, you will observe annoying freezes and micro stutters, even though the FPS counter will show excessive values. Instead, they kept the identical figures as before and simply sliced 10W off the PL2 worth. So it would appear that issues over warmth output and the worth of electricity are very much individual issues.
Megahertz and gigahertz are the units used to measure processing velocity in a CPU. You should upgrade your GPU first if you’re an lively gamer, video editor, or have had the GPU for greater than four years. In some cases, it’s finest to upgrade the CPU first as a result of it’s extra cost-friendly, longer-lasting, and controls every side of the system, apart from graphics.